A full system-wide installation, like the one in jhalfs-0.2, isn't easy to do due that there is a lot of files that need be found in their proper locations. That is why I propose create a separate install-jhalfs.sh script that will do: - To copy the full sources tree to a selected directory (downloading and unpacking a tarball and/or via svn) - To create a jhalfs wraper placing it into a directory already in the PATH. That script could to perfom a cd to the sources dir an run the appropiate script whit the suplied switches.
